We call out time decay—the slow leak of potential through fear, indecision, and distraction—and build a plan to reclaim our minutes with awareness, discipline, and simple systems. We trade busy for aligned, swap scrolling for creation, and finish with affirmations that set the week.

• defining time decay and why minutes matter 
• awareness of autopilot, social media, and negative inputs 
• consistency over perfection as the real edge 
• money mindset, assets, and turning time into wealth 
• the 3R formula: reassess, restructure, reinvest 
• automation, time banking, and simple daily swaps 
• fear of failure and fear of success psychology 
• prompts to act now and design a present‑tense version of success 
• closing affirmations to anchor intention

And I'm using the test as an example so you can kind of see how I'm also getting myself ready to use my time to benefit my future self. So, what's the strategy? I'm gonna go over the 3R formula. The strategy, I need you to edit it and streamline it so it would make it better flow and with more sense. When the live stream is over, I will share with you in the comments what I have written so far for my drag and dentist story. Okay. So the 3R formula that's reassess, restructure, reinvest. So, in order for you to reclaim your time and redefine your success, you gotta reassess what you're doing in life. What truly matters to you, what is going to make your future self happy, what makes you happy, honestly. And then you gotta restructure. Where can you simplify or automate your time? In the day of AI, this is so easy to do with all the different tools that we have. You can easily restructure your time. Chat GPT is my assistant. I love it. It saves me so much time. If you have not downloaded it and are not using it, I suggest you do that today. But don't just use it to ask crazy questions, use it to help you reassess yourself, restructure your time. And the last R is reinvest. This is very, very key to reinvest in yourself. Put time back into your purpose, put time back into your skills, or into your rest. Because success is not busyness, success is aligning with who you are, and only you can answer that question today. My future self will be thankful for me staying in the right path. Absolutely. Absolutely. So once you reassess, restructure, and reinvest, you're on the right path. All right.
